Senior HW Dev Engineer - Antenna Systems, Leo Hardware Development

Summary

The Senior Hardware Engineer will design and optimize advanced antenna systems for Project Kuiper's satellite constellation, including developing prototypes, RF circuitry, and automated test systems. The role involves leading PCB layout efforts and conducting antenna bring-up and testing campaigns.

Project Kuiper is an initiative to launch a constellation of Low Earth Orbit satellites that will provide low-latency, high-speed broadband connectivity to unserved and underserved communities around the world.

As a Senior Hardware Engineer, you will be a part of the team of experts working on the development of advanced antenna systems. You will own or contribute to the following:

· Design and optimization of different blocks of antennas system
· Design the proof of concept systems and prototypes for the next generation of the antennas
· Design of RF circuitry in collaboration with RF team
· Design of automated test systems, test fixtures and factory test
· Bring-up and test campaigns of the active antennas
· Lead and review PCB layout
